The My First LeapPad - Blue is an innovative educational tool designed for young learners, featuring a blue computer system, a writing stylus, and a speaker. It comes with three interactive cartridges and seven engaging books, all housed in a convenient backpack case, making it perfect for learning on the go.

Great Idea but more of an aggravation!!!
This toy has such great learning abilities if the construction of the toy was different. If you use the book that comes with this it is not a problem, but to change books you have to have a cartridge that is inserted into the right SIDE (the handle is on the left)and this cartridge sticks out about an inch. If your toddler even TOUCHES it, it shuts off. My daughter tends to use her left hand so she naturally grabs the right side and hence the total aggravation. For the amount of $ it is for this and the books, wait until they change the design!!

Good Toy, But Doesn't Hold Up to Toddler Use
I bought this toy for my two daughters, aged 2 and 4. After three months of use the unit intermittently wouldn't recognize the cartridges that we would plug into it. The problem got worse over time and now the pen works intermittently as well. My girls were never wild with it, never threw it against a wall or blatantly abused it, just normal toddler use. My First Leappad was fun while it worked, but my advice is to save your money and wait until your kids are old enough for the regular Leappad.

Son still plays with this after 1 year!
I really like My first leap pad and so does my 3 year old son. I bought it for him for Christmas last year (he was 2 1/2 then)and though some the activities we're alittle hard for him to start with, there were still plenty of things he could do with it.Every picture you touch the pen on says a frase/says the name of the object or make a sound,so even without playing the games he still had great fun with it. A year on,he can now play all the games on it and has recently noticed letters make words,so now he touches the words and the leap pad reads it for him,so he is still learning from this toy after a year! I will be buying more my first leap pad books for him this Christmas,this toy is worth every penny!
